        Re: adding another site

        Create a different directory on YOUR COMPUTER

        open BV (1 copy only required)

        create another index page and save it to your 2nd site folder on your computer.

        publish this 2nd index page to:

        (change the publish dropdown box (3 boxes) to the info you received for your 2nd site)...........that part is important

        public_html/nameofyouraddon2ndsite.com

        All the above assumes that you have already added this 2nd site as an addon in your Cpanel..................
